Office Assistant III (VACANCIES FOR VARIOUS DEPARTMENTS)

DescriptionUnder general supervision, perform moderately complex and semi-specialized clerical support duties; may supervise other clerical employees.
Examples of Duties Type from rough draft important and/or confidential correspondence and reports.
Assemble data and information and enter into defined tabular format.
Determine the pertinence, adequacy, arrangement and form of reports or correspondence requiring familiarity with departmental rules, policies and procedures.
Proofread and check accuracy of work.
Determine classification of material for filing.
Perform filing of correspondence, records and reports.
Maintain records in databases, spreadsheets and logs, requiring knowledge of departmental practices and procedures.
Maintain confidential records and files.
Schedule appointments and maintain calendars.
Issue licenses and permits, determining eligibility through verifying documentation.
Accept payments and issue receipts.
Screen telephone calls and visitors and assist with nontechnical inquiries Plan, schedule and review work of subordinates.
Supervise group of clerical employees.
Procure and monitor inventory of office materials and supplies.
Minimum QualificationsQualifications (required):
High School graduation or G.
E.
D.
(General Educational Development) equivalent with coursework in typing, keyboarding, word processing, and office management or business related subjects.
Two (2) years of recent office experience performing moderately complex clerical and office work.
Qualifications (preferred):
Experience in a City department.
Two (2) years of college courses preferable with proficiency in Microsoft Office products.
EquivalencyEquivalent combinations of education and experience that provide the required knowledge, skills, and abilities will be evaluated on an individual basis.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
